- [ ] Step 7: Archive cold storage buckets (Glacierline tier). Confirm both ceremony witnesses are present, verify bucket manifests match the Oxbow ledger, then seal the archive key shares. Plugin authors may observe but not handle shares. Once sealed, the archive index itself is encrypted and can only be reopened with the passphrase below.

vault phrase of badup-hahig = tamael-aldael-kelmir-istael-fenok-istwyn-tamius-jorath-oliion

Rates cached per jurisdiction code for 6 hours; stale entries refreshed lazily on read.
- Cache bypass flag `rates.cache.disabled` added for audits.
- Fixed double-fetch race when two requests miss simultaneously; now coalesced via single-flight guard.
- Metrics: hit ratio, eviction count, refresh latency exported under `pennywhistle.ratecache.*`.

Reviewers: verify jurisdiction normalization before cache keying. Questions about this change go to the responsible engineer named below.

account owner for bawip-tahag: Raleth Quenok

# Supplier Contract Renewal — Quennel Materials

**Access: Managers only**

The three-year supply agreement with Quennel Materials expires at the end of Q3. Procurement recommends renewal with revised volume tiers; the Hallowick plant depends on their resin feedstock. Legal has reviewed termination clauses and found no blockers.

For the incoming director: decision is due before the Brinmore offsite. The context below explains why timing matters.

confidential, kagup-bafog: Fraaxax Group is in early talks to buy Soroxox Group for about $343.8 million. The Olidor launch date is June 14, and nothing goes to the press before then. Legal wants the Aldmirek Logistics term sheet signed before July 23.

Compaction in the Brambleton queue runs hourly per topic; tombstones persist for 48h before purge. Review scope: compaction never rewrites payloads, only drops superseded keys. Audit logs for compaction cycles ship to the Cindervault sink. The compactor authenticates to the broker with a dedicated secret, which your local env file must set on the following line.

secret setting of hawep-yahig: LEDGER_TOKEN29=41b5d6315371c92885eaeb077fb63